Roulette Strategies That Actually Work (Sort Of)

Let me be clear: no strategy can beat the house edge long term. But some systems help you manage your bankroll and extend your playtime. Here is what I tested during my sessions.

  • Martingale: Double your bet after a loss. Works until you hit a losing streak. I went from £1 bets to £16 in four spins. Won back my losses on the fifth spin. Risky.
  • Reverse Martingale: Double after a win. I tried this on LeoVegas. Won three in a row, then lost. Net profit: £4. Not bad.
  • Flat betting: Just bet the same amount every spin. Boring but sustainable. I did this at 888 Casino and lasted 90 minutes on a £30 bankroll.

None of these are foolproof. The wheel is random. But they give you a structure so you don’t tilt and blow your whole bankroll in five minutes.

What is the best roulette variant for real money?

European Roulette has the best odds with a 2.7% house edge. French Roulette is even better if the “La Partage” rule applies (half your bet back on zero). Avoid American Roulette (5.26% edge) unless you are just having fun.
